Catalog description
This course explores the scientific evidence for anthropogenic climate change, as well as its effects upon nature and society. Topics include the climate system, natural climate variability, anthropogenic drivers of climate change, the carbon cycle, phenology, ecosystem changes, and other climate change impacts on biological systems. This course incorporates information from biology, chemistry, and physics to address these topics.
